CAS: 76-59-5 | C27H28Br2O5S | 624.384 g/mol

Bromothymol Blue is a pH indicator used for measuring pH around 7 in pools and fish tanks. It operates in the pH range 6.0 to 7.6 due to the presence of an electron withdrawing and donating groups like bromine atoms and alkyl substitutents respectively. In the laboratory, it is used as a biological slide stain as well as used in obstetrics for detecting premature rupture of membranes. Further, it is used for the observation of photosynthetic activities and a respiratory indicator. In addition to this, it is used to define cell walls or nuclei under the microscope.

Solubility
Soluble in ethanol, ether and alkalis. Slightly soluble in water.

Notes
Incompatible with strong oxidizing agents.
